    ATF, the thing to understand is, though, is that it's next to impossible to accurately author harmonies with only one vocal track. I'm going through the same s*** with Unicron (a band you'd probably never be in to), and it's really time consuming and near impossible. Not only that, but most of the time it'll sound really off if you author harmonies not matter if you're correct or not.

    I'm not saying that this criticism is bad or anything. But I am saying that I at least understand his viewpoint.
    I've charted vocal harmonies before, even vocal harmonies on one track. The difficulty is something that varies between people based on their understanding of music and music theory. I'm not saying that Ozone is being deliberately sloppy (although, that may be a possibility), I'm just saying that he should look for someone who knows what they're doing better, because charting harmonies on one track is not totally impossible, it's just the same as, say, charting chords on pro keys. Some people can do it better than others, but if someone can't, it's in their best interest to either get better or find someone who can do it.

    I agree, but until Microsoft allows true bundling, it ain't gonna happen. Ozone's Pac-Man packs happened by having the tracks that made up the packs all release the same day, but you still had to buy each track separately.
